Hi, we had sent Prof Rutledge mail about this last week, which
is why I suggested contacting him. An Athena SGI release update
occurred earlier in the week. Here's what the mail had to say:
"Please note that both /etc/inetd.conf and /etc/athena/inetd.conf have
been modified by this update. Because mkserv became available only
recently for the SGI, some people may have modified their inetd.conf
files by hand to unswitch remote access services, and those changes
will be undone by the update (though people's old Athena inetd.conf
files will be backed up in /etc/athena/inetd.conf.old). The new,
proper way to make an SGI remotely accessible is to run "mkserv
remote" as root."
So, you or he can either put the old inetd.conf
back in place, or rerun mkserv remote.
